I've written an add in that creates button's on the standard toolbar.
As part of this it sets the icons via the FaceID property.

My addin was written against Office 2003 but will also need to run on
user machines that have Office 2000.

Are all of the FaceId icons automatically in built in a standard
installation of Word ?   I'm worried that on a bog standard install of
Word 2000 that some of my icons won't be available.

Do I need to deploy any of the Word FaceID icons ?

My general observation is that you won't have a problem, unless you've used
a FaceId that is new since Word 2000. And no, I have no idea if a list of
those exists.

However, I have had a couple of problems with toolbars where I tried to move
a Word 2003 add-in back to Word 2000, even when I knew that the FaceIds were
as old as the hills.

The only way to know for sure is to test your addin in Word 2000.

Word 1 went to about 100.
The FaceIDs you are most likely to use have low IDs.
I guess with Word 2000, up to about 3000 should be safe.

Word2002/2003 added IDs up to close to 10.000... I would not use those.
